The Global MRI-guided Radiation Therapy Systems Market was valued at USD 754 million in 2023 and is projected to reach USD 1.8 billion by 2031, growing at a CAGR of 11.2% during the forecast period from 2023 to 2031. MRI-guided radiation therapy (MRIgRT) represents a major breakthrough in precision oncology, combining magnetic resonance imaging (MRI) with radiation therapy to enhance tumor targeting while minimizing damage to healthy tissues. This market is driven by the growing prevalence of cancer worldwide, increasing demand for non-invasive and personalized treatment approaches, and technological advancements in imaging-guided therapy systems.

Drivers:

Rising Cancer Incidence:

The increasing global burden of cancer is the primary driver for MRI-guided radiation therapy systems. With millions of new cancer cases diagnosed each year, the demand for advanced, accurate, and patient-friendly treatment options continues to surge.

Technological Innovations in Radiation Oncology:

Advancements such as real-time imaging, adaptive therapy, and high-definition magnetic resonance imaging are enhancing the capabilities of MRIgRT systems. These innovations support better treatment planning and increased safety, fueling market growth.

Shift Towards Personalized Medicine:

The movement toward patient-specific treatment regimens in oncology has amplified the adoption of MRIgRT systems. These systems allow for adaptive radiation therapy tailored to the individual’s anatomy and tumor characteristics in real time.

Restraints:

High Cost of Equipment and Installation:

The high acquisition and operational costs of MRIgRT systems present a significant barrier, especially for smaller hospitals and clinics in developing regions. Installation also demands specific infrastructure and shielding, adding to overall expenses.

Limited Availability of Skilled Professionals:

Effective use of MRI-guided systems requires trained professionals including radiation oncologists, physicists, and radiologists. A lack of such expertise can limit the adoption of these systems in many regions.

Opportunity:

Expansion in Emerging Markets:

As healthcare infrastructure develops in Asia-Pacific, Latin America, and the Middle East, emerging economies present lucrative opportunities for MRIgRT system manufacturers. Government investments in oncology care and favorable reimbursement policies are supporting market entry.

Integration with Artificial Intelligence:

The integration of AI for real-time image analysis and adaptive treatment planning enhances the efficiency of MRIgRT systems. AI-driven innovations can optimize workflow, reduce treatment time, and improve patient outcomes, offering immense market potential.

Market by System Type Insights:

The Hybrid MRI-Linac Systems segment accounted for the largest market share in 2023. These systems combine linear accelerators with MRI imaging for real-time tumor tracking and radiation delivery, providing high precision and adaptability during treatment. The segment continues to dominate due to its versatility, accuracy, and growing preference in high-volume oncology centers.

Market by End-use Insights:

In terms of end use, the Hospitals & Cancer Treatment Centers segment held over 65% of the market share in 2023. These facilities are the primary adopters of MRI-guided systems due to their comprehensive infrastructure, specialized staff, and high patient throughput. Meanwhile, research institutes are emerging as fast-growing end-users, driven by ongoing clinical trials and product development.

Market by Regional Insights:

North America led the market in 2023, driven by strong healthcare infrastructure, high awareness of advanced cancer treatments, and the presence of major players like ViewRay and Elekta. However, the Asia-Pacific region is projected to experience the fastest growth during the forecast period, supported by rising healthcare investments, expanding cancer incidence, and adoption of precision medicine in countries like China, India, and Japan.

Key Market Developments:

June 2023: ViewRay received FDA clearance for the MRIdian A3i system with advanced real-time tracking and adaptive therapy tools.

October 2023: Elekta entered a multi-year agreement with leading hospitals in Japan to install Unity MRI-guided radiation systems.

March 2024: Siemens Healthineers launched a collaborative research initiative to explore AI-enabled MRIgRT in partnership with top oncology institutions in Europe.
